JBRX - Analyze NPV


SAP Transaction Code - Details

  • Transaction Code: JBRX

    Description: Analyze NPV

    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6

    Menu Path:

    • Accounting > Financial Supply Chain Management > Treasury and Risk Management > Transaction Manager > Information System > Reports > Risk Settings > Risk Analysis > Mark-to-Market > NPV analysis
    • Accounting > Financial Supply Chain Management > Treasury and Risk Management > Market Risk Analyzer > Information System > Mark-to-Market > Analyze NPV
    • Accounting > Financial Supply Chain Management > Treasury and Risk Management > Market Risk Analyzer > Asset/Liability Management > Information System > Single Value Analyses > NPV Analysis
    • Information Systems > Accounting > Treasury > Risk Settings > Risk Analysis > Mark-to-Market > NPV analysis
    • Information Systems > General Report Selection > Treasury > Risk Settings > Risk Analysis > Mark-to-Market > NPV analysis
  • Show technical details Hide technical details
    • Program: RJBRSVAC

      Screen: 1000

      Authorization Object: J_B_TRANSB

    • Development Package: JBR

      Package Description: Application development TRM Market Risk Mangement

      Parent Package: FS_SEM_TRMAN

    • Module/Component: FIN-FSCM-TRM-AN

      Description: Analyzer
